VirtualAppliances.net has released the latest build of their LAMP (Linux, Apache, MySQL, PHP) virtual appliance. Details of the release are below.
VirtualAppliances.net has released build 110 of its popular LAMP
Virtual Appliance. This LAMP (Linux, Apache, MySQL, PHP/Python/Perl)
server appliance can be downloaded and running within a matter of
minutes.
Quick & Easy Web Application Deployment
Installing a wide range of web applications is as easy as dragging and
dropping the package into the LAMP VAs shared document root. This
Virtual Appliance's footprint is as tiny (59MB to download) as it is
easy to use (no Linux skills required).
Many Other Software Updates
This release is packed with new features based on user feedback,
software updates, improvments, and is available for VMware, Microsoft
Virtual PC & Virtual Server, and Virtual Iron.
Shell Access now enabled!
Based on user feedback, shell access via VMware console & SSH is
turned on by default. It is now possible to edit the Apache HTTP
Server configuration, edit crontab entries, install your own files,
and manage additional storage.
Additional New Features
* Network configuration improvements, including the addition of
support for static network routes
* Additional built-in PHP modules enabled for improved compatibility
with popular web applications
* PEAR -PHP Extension and Application Repository support for
end-user management of PHP extensions
* Apache SSL support

Web Application Compatibility
The LAMP VA has been tested with many third-party applications
including:
* Drupal, open source content management platform
* phpBB, popular discussion forum software
* punBB, discussion forum software
* MediaWiki, the wiki software on which Wikipedia is built!
* Simple Machines Forum, refined discussion forum software
* Gallery, open source web based photo album organizer
* YaBB, open source community forum system written in Perl
* WordPress, blog tool and weblog platform
